The overwhelming majority of solar cells are fabricated from silicon —with increasing efficiency and lowering cost as the materials range from amorphous (noncrystalline) to polycrystalline to crystalline (single crystal ) silicon forms. The vast majority of today's solar cells are made from siliconand offer both reasonable prices and good efficiency (the rate at which the solar cell converts sunlight into electricity). These solar cells are composed of two different types of semiconductors—a p-type and an n-type—that are joined together to create a p-n junction.
